Joe McClung has a building next to Basin Park. Turpentine Creek currently occupies it. The building has allegedly been encroached upon by Dan Harriman, who illegally tore down the old Queenie Deer House, and then pushed, cut away, chopped off parts of, and otherwise encroached on McClung’s building, McClung’s expert witness says.
